Ergebnis 1 bis 16 von 16

Thema: Seit 2.7.4 JS-Felder/Boxen/Popups im Backend nicht mehr korrekt angezeigt

  1. #1
    Contao-Fan
    Registriert seit
    08.07.2009.
    Beiträge
    533

    Beitrag Seit 2.7.4 JS-Felder/Boxen/Popups im Backend nicht mehr korrekt angezeigt

    Hallo,

    ich habe nach dem Update bzw. der Neuinstallation von TL 2.7.4 das Problem,
    dass die JS-Felder/Boxen/Popups im Backend nicht mehr korrekt angezeigt werden.
    Dies tritt z.B. bei den Stylesheets unter dem Punkt "Größe und Position" auf. Bisher wurde hier bei einem Klick in die Checkbox das Feld darunter geöffnet, jetzt passiert nichts mehr.

    Mittlerweile habe ich herausgefunden, dass es an meinen zusätzlichen Einträgen in der .htaccess-datei liegt. Dort habe ich zusätzlich zu den automatisch generierten Einträgen die Zeilen:

    php_value session.save_path /www/htdocs/***/***/temp
    AddHandler php-fastcgi .php

    hinzugefügt. Provider ist all-inkl, bei der Version 2.7.3 hatte ich damit keine Probleme. Worin besteht hier der Zusammehang mit dem Fehler? Kann mit evtl. jemand einen Tipp geben?

    Danke und LG
    hangover
    Geändert von bird (01.10.2009 um 00:31 Uhr)

  2. #2
    Contao-Fan
    Registriert seit
    19.06.2009.
    Beiträge
    837

    Standard

    Könnte ein Cache-Problem sein, da die mootool upgedated wurden.
    Browsercache leeren und falls du über eine Proxy ins Inetrnet gehst, könnten die javascripts auch dort gecached sein.
    Gruß ChrMue

  3. #3
    Contao-Fan
    Registriert seit
    08.07.2009.
    Beiträge
    533

    Standard

    Hallo,

    das dürfte es eigentlich nicht sein. Ich nutze keinen Proxyserver und habe den Browsercache mehrfach geleert.

    Ich habe mittlerweile festgestellt, dass es gar nicht an meinen Einträgen liegt.
    Sobald man die Standard ._htaccess in .htaccess umbenennt, tritt der Fehler auf. Der "Fehler" kommt also schon in den org. Dateien mit!?

    Es liegt wohl an diesen Zeilen, denn sobald man diese löscht, funktioniert alles im BE wieder normal:

    # Compress .js and .css files
    ##
    AddEncoding gzip .gz
    <FilesMatch "\.js\.gz$">
    AddType "text/javascript" .gz
    </FilesMatch>
    <FilesMatch "\.css\.gz$">
    AddType "text/css" .gz
    </FilesMatch>
    RewriteCond %{HTTP:Accept-encoding} gzip
    RewriteCond %{REQUEST_FILENAME} \.(js|css)$
    RewriteCond %{REQUEST_FILENAME}.gz -f
    RewriteRule ^(.*)$ $1.gz [QSA,L]

    LG
    Geändert von bird (01.10.2009 um 00:40 Uhr)

  4. #4
    Contao-Fan
    Registriert seit
    19.06.2009.
    Beiträge
    837

    Standard

    Das kann es eigentlich auch nicht sein, denn bei mir funktioniert alles. (mit URL-Umschreibung, html als Extension und mit .htaccess)

    Hast du die URL-Umschreibung aktiviert und .html als suffix?
    Geändert von ChrMue (02.10.2009 um 15:39 Uhr)

  5. #5
    Contao-Fan
    Registriert seit
    08.07.2009.
    Beiträge
    533

    Standard

    Ja, ich habe URL-Umschreibung aktiviert und *.html als Suffix gelassen.
    Kann es hier ein Problem geben, wenn ich TL in einem Unterordner installiere?
    Also domain.de/test/test

    Liegt das evtl. an den Einstellungen des Providers?

    Ich habe das jetzt mal nach dem Ausschlussprinzip getestet, es macht diese Zeile ein Problem:

    RewriteRule ^(.*)$ $1.gz [QSA,L]
    Geändert von bird (01.10.2009 um 00:58 Uhr)

  6. #6
    Contao-Fan
    Registriert seit
    19.06.2009.
    Beiträge
    837

    Standard

    wenn du auch den relativen Pfad zum TYPOlight-Verzeichnis gesetzt hast, fällt mir im Moment auch nix mehr ein.

  7. #7
    Contao-Fan
    Registriert seit
    08.07.2009.
    Beiträge
    533

    Standard

    Ja, der relative Pfad ist entsprechend zum Unterordner gesetzt.
    Was soll dieser Block eigentlich bewirken? Ich kenne mich in Sachen .htaccess nicht so aus. Kann ich den vorest ohne Probleme auskommentieren?

    AddEncoding gzip .gz
    <FilesMatch "\.js\.gz$">
    AddType "text/javascript" .gz
    </FilesMatch>
    <FilesMatch "\.css\.gz$">
    AddType "text/css" .gz
    </FilesMatch>
    RewriteCond %{HTTP:Accept-encoding} gzip
    RewriteCond %{REQUEST_FILENAME} \.(js|css)$
    RewriteCond %{REQUEST_FILENAME}.gz -f
    # RewriteRule ^(.*)$ $1.gz [QSA,L]

  8. #8
    Contao-Fan
    Registriert seit
    19.06.2009.
    Beiträge
    837

    Standard

    in der letzte Zeile stand bisher nur ...[L]
    das wurde geändert in [QSA, L]
    muss ich mal nachsehen, was das bedeutet, ... aber heute nicht mehr
    Geändert von ChrMue (02.10.2009 um 15:40 Uhr) Grund: Tippfehler

  9. #9
    Administrator Avatar von Nina
    Registriert seit
    04.06.2009.
    Ort
    Hamburg
    Beiträge
    4.756
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Zitat Zitat von ChrMue Beitrag anzeigen
    wdas wurde geändert in [QSA, L]
    muss ich mal nachsehen, was das bedeutet, ... aber heute nicht mehr
    QSA bedeutet, dass ein eventueller Query String erhalten bleibt.
    L bedeutet, dass das die endgültige Vorgabe für den Regelfall ist und von nachfolgenden Regeln daran nichts mehr umgeschrieben werden soll.

  10. #10
    Administrator Avatar von Nina
    Registriert seit
    04.06.2009.
    Ort
    Hamburg
    Beiträge
    4.756
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Zitat Zitat von hangover Beitrag anzeigen
    ich habe nach dem Update bzw. der Neuinstallation von TL 2.7.4 das Problem,
    dass die JS-Felder/Boxen/Popups im Backend nicht mehr korrekt angezeigt werden.
    Dies tritt z.B. bei den Stylesheets unter dem Punkt "Größe und Position" auf. Bisher wurde hier bei einem Klick in die Checkbox das Feld darunter geöffnet, jetzt passiert nichts mehr.
    Ich bin mit ein paar Projekten auch bei All-Inkl und kann den Effekt nicht bestätigen. Habe ein LiveUpdate auf die 2.7.4 gemacht, danach ausgeloggt und den Browsercache gelöscht. Nach dem Einloggen bin ich dann gleich mal testweise in die Stylesheets gemacht und alles funktionierte wie gehabt.

    Mal so ein paar Ideen woran das Problem bei dir liegen könnte:
    • Hast du das Update per LiveUpdate oder anders gemacht? Möglicherweise wurden bestimmte Daten nicht sauber übertragen.
    • Vielleicht ist bei dir der Browsercache nicht sauber geleert worden, so dass er zum Teil noch alte Files aus dem Cache zieht. Wenn das bei Javascript passiert, kann das schnell dazu führen, dass die Effekte nicht richtig laufen.
    • Hast du GZIP in den Einstellungen aktiviert? Vielleicht gibt es bei der Nutzung der php-cgi Variante bei All-Inkl da ein Problem in der Serverkonfiguration (ich nutze bei den beiden Projekten den SMH statt php-cgi).

  11. #11
    Contao-Fan
    Registriert seit
    08.07.2009.
    Beiträge
    533

    Standard

    Hallo,

    das Update habe ich manuell durchgeführt.
    Um sicher zu gehen, dass es nicht an einem fehlerhaften Update liegt, habe ich auch eine komplette Neuinstallation mit der v 2.7.4 durchgeführt. Das Ergebnis ist leider gleich...

    Sobald ich diese Ziele nicht auskommentiere, tritt das Problem auf:
    # RewriteRule ^(.*)$ $1.gz [QSA,L]

    Wie kann ich GZIP aktivieren bzw. feststellen, ob da ein Konflikt mit der php-cgi besteht? Support von all-inkl fragen?

    Was mir noch aufgefallen ist - der Farb-Selektor im BE funktioniertteilweise nicht mehr richtig. Die restlichen Funktionen laufen, wenn die o.g. Zeile auskommentiert ist, der Farbselektor wird aber nur als Bild ohne Funktion angezeigt.

    Danke + LG
    hangover
    Geändert von bird (01.10.2009 um 12:01 Uhr)

  12. #12
    Administrator Avatar von Nina
    Registriert seit
    04.06.2009.
    Ort
    Hamburg
    Beiträge
    4.756
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Die Sache wegen GZIP kannst du im TYPOlight-Backend unter "Einstellungen" ein- bzw. ausstellen.

    Das mit dem Farbwähler funktioniert bei meiner All-Inkl Installation ebenfalls völlig korrekt.

  13. #13
    Contao-Nutzer
    Registriert seit
    29.07.2009.
    Beiträge
    39

    Standard

    Ich habe das gleiche Problem.

    Habe eine Erstinstallation durchgeführt und habe das Problem trotzdem. Hat jemand das Problem schon gelöst??

  14. #14
    Contao-Nutzer
    Registriert seit
    29.07.2009.
    Beiträge
    39

    Standard

    OK.
    Hat sich erledigt. Hatte die htaccess in den falschen Ordner kopiert.

  15. #15
    Contao-Fan
    Registriert seit
    08.07.2009.
    Beiträge
    533

    Standard

    Hallo,

    bei mir hat sich das Problem momentan auf rätselhafte Weise auch gelöst...
    Ich habe die GZIP-Einstellungen im Backend angewählt, gespeichert, wieder abgewählt, gespeichert und dann ging es...

    Auch wenn das rational wahrscheinlich keinen Sinn macht - geholfen hat es...
    Danke für die Unterstützung, ich hoffe, alles bleibt jetzt so.

    LG
    hangover

  16. #16
    Administrator Avatar von Nina
    Registriert seit
    04.06.2009.
    Ort
    Hamburg
    Beiträge
    4.756
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Das sind dann wohl die Mysterien des Internets
    Aber gut, dass es nun funktioniert

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Ähnliche Themen

  1. Nachrichten: Dateisätze werden im Backend nicht mehr angezeigt
    Von konnie im Forum Allgemeine Inhaltselemente
    Antworten: 3
    Letzter Beitrag: 24.01.2011, 14:19
  2. seit Lightbox4ward fkt. bildlink nicht mehr
    Von zetzi im Forum "...4ward"
    Antworten: 2
    Letzter Beitrag: 03.05.2010, 11:07
  3. Backend Module werden nicht mehr angezeigt
    Von melodora im Forum Sonstiges zu Contao
    Antworten: 8
    Letzter Beitrag: 08.12.2009, 11:37
  4. Gelöst: Nachrichten werden im Backend nicht mehr angezeigt
    Von ipalme im Forum Nachrichten/Events/FAQ
    Antworten: 6
    Letzter Beitrag: 02.09.2009, 21:50

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•